Game Overview

Rushing Beat Ran – Fukusei Toshi (Japan) is a hidden gem in the Super Nintendo library that throws you into a gritty, cyberpunk-style beat ‘em up with a twist. Imagine Final Fight meets Streets of Rage, but with a darker, more futuristic edge—where neon-lit streets and criminal syndicates set the stage for brutal brawls. You pick from a trio of tough fighters, each with their own unique moves, and plow through waves of thugs in a city teeming with corruption. What makes Rushing Beat Ran stand out? Its combo-heavy combat, slick animations, and a killer soundtrack that amps up the adrenaline.

This game is actually part of the Rushing Beat trilogy (Rival Turf! and Brawl Brothers in the West), but Fukusei Toshi (meaning "Replica City") never left Japan—making it a must-play for import hunters and retro fans. It’s got that classic ‘90s arcade vibe with just enough depth to keep you hooked. If you love old-school brawlers with attitude, this one’s a knockout punch of nostalgia and hard-hitting action.
